My plan previously renewed on the 28th each month, I then paused it for a short while. When I reactive it (on say the 10th) is it activated within a day or two with a new monthly renewal day or is the plan inactive until the following 28th.

@ChrisSe_1165309 Sorry, I thought that my reply of 10;48 today did make that clear.

The relevant date is when you start the plan so, if you start on the 8th of this month, renewal would be due on the 8th of next month. If you choose not to renew (i.e. turn off auto renew) until 25th of next month, then that would be the activation date and the plan would last for one month from then.
